The Perricone cosmeceutical line is amazing. It's expensive but worth it, and you use so little, the bottles last a long time. I use the Alpha Lipoic Acid Face Firming Activator with DMAE in the morning. At night I alternate between the Vitamin C Ester Concentrated Restorative Cream with DMAE and Ativa (a milder form of Retin A, available by prescription). For cleansing and general moisturizing, I use Cetaphil products (available in most drug stores).

Let me tell you one not to waste your$$$ on and that's kinerase. My husband is a dermatologist and I am a nurse and work in his office. I get to see a lot of before and after's. Nobody so far has been impressed w/kinerase. Retin-A micro seem's to work well but it's prescription. I'm with Fitfossil cetaphil is a great cleanser. And the little I've heard of The Perricone line is all good:D Alway's , alway's use sun screen ,even if you think you aren't going to be in the sun.
